Additive manufacturing (AM) techniques make fabricating complex designs, prototypes, and end-user products possible. Conductive polymer composites find applications in flexible electronics, sensor fabrication, electrical circuits. In this study, thermoplastic polyurethane (TPU)-based conductive composite samples were fabricated via fused filament fabrication (FFF). The effects of three important process parameters, including infill density (ID), layer thickness (LT), fan speed (FS), on various mechanical properties (tensile compressive properties) investigated. It was observed that all the considered parameters affect properties, they are significant as per analysis variance (ANOVA). From scanning electron microscopy (SEM) optical microscopy, combinations such low ID, high LT, FS resulted formation defects voids, cracks, warping, which properties. Finally, parameter optimization performed, resulting a with best possible combination at medium FS.

Compared with conventional pneumatic tyres, non-pneumatic tyres (NPTs) have various advantages such as zero-blowout risk, maintenance-free, and environment-friendliness. Instead of compressed air, NPTs employ elastic spokes the main load-carrying structure. Honeycomb flexible radial are commonly used types, spoke geometries also continuously emerging. In this study, an innovative NPT V-shape was developed. With specially designed spokes, can achieve better supporting performance aerodynamic characteristics. A finite element (FE) model constructed for proposed NPT, mechanical properties were studied. Prototypes fabricated, experimental test confirmed fidelity FE model. To reveal impact mechanism design parameters on we Taguchi method parametric analysis. Based verified model, orthogonal simulations conducted to study interactions among multi-axis radial, longitudinal, lateral, torsional stiffnesses. result analysis, principles extracted satisfy its property demands.

Increasing environmental concerns and the need for sustainable materials have driven a focus towards utilization of recycled polylactic acid (PLA) in additive manufacturing as PLA offers advantages over other thermoplastics, including biodegradability, ease processing, lower impact during production. This study explores optimization mechanical properties parts through combination experimental machine learning approaches. A series experiments were conducted to investigate various processing parameters, such layer thickness infill density, well annealing conditions, on parts. Machine algorithms proven possibility predict tensile behavior with an average error 6.059%. The results demonstrate that specific combinations parameters post-treatment differently improve (with 7.31% ultimate strength (UTS), 0.28% Young's modulus, 3.68% elongation) crystallinity 22.33%) according XRD analysis, making it viable alternative virgin applications packaging solutions, biodegradable containers, clamshell packaging, protective inserts. optimized exhibited levels comparable those their counterparts, highlighting potential reducing saving costs. For both as-built annealed samples, optimal settings achieving high composite desirability involved 0.2 mm thickness, 75% samples 100% samples. provides comprehensive framework optimizing manufacturing, contributing advancement material engineering circular economy.
